About the Role

As a Senior Medical Writer, you'll report directly to the Associate Creative Director and collaborate with cross-functional teams, including Creative, Strategy, Account Service, and Project Management. You will:

 
  • Translate complex scientific and medical concepts into clear, engaging content.
  • Craft a variety of medical writing materials such as slide decks, websites, branded campaigns, and patient education tools.
  • Ensure all content is medically accurate, audience-appropriate, on-brand, and compliant with regulatory standards.
  • Contribute to internal brainstorming and briefing sessions to shape effective communication strategies.
  • Support editorial processes from initial draft to final proofing with meticulous attention to detail.
  • Provide feedback and help enhance internal content development practices.
  • Collaborate with team members across disciplines to ensure cohesive project execution.
  • Participate in new business pitches and proposals with well-researched medical insights.
  • Engage in occasional client-facing activities, including presenting your work.
  • Build and maintain relationships with medical directors and stakeholders.
  • Stay informed on current trends in medical education and the pharmaceutical industry.
  • Get involved in non-medical and consumer healthcare content where applicable.
  • Support faculty engagement, manuscript development, and information gathering.
  • Uphold high editorial standards through consistent proofreading and quality control.
